Object detection is broadly utilized in robot navigation, clever video surveillance, industrial inspection, aerospace and lots of different fields. It is a vital department of image processing and pc vision disciplines, and can be the core a part of clever surveillance methods. At the identical time, target detection can also be a primary algorithm in the field of pan-identification, which performs a vital role in subsequent tasks similar to face recognition, gait recognition, crowd counting, and instance segmentation.
